Many causes for throat pain but possible causes I'm discussing here 1. GERD with reflux pharyngitis. 2. Viral or streptococcus infection. 3. Thyroiditis pain 4. Chronic granular pharyngitis 5. Globus pharyngitis 6. Esophagitis etcetera. Until examination by endoscopy, barium swallow it is difficult to say what it is. Please consult your doctor he will examine and treat you accordingly.
